'A Place in the Sun' is the third album by the California Pop-rock group Pablo Cruise, originally released in 1977. The album marked an entrance into the mainstream for the band, charting at #19 on the US Billboard 200. This would be the group's last project with original bassist Bud Cockrell, who left the band after its release.
The first single from the album, 'Whatcha Gonna Do?' reached #6 on the Pop Singles charts. The title track, 'A Place in the Sun' was the second successful single on the album, reaching #42, and remains the favorite among many fans of the band today. The track 'Raging Fire' was released as the B-side of "I Go to Rio" in 1978.
